12 Atlanta gifts for him
1. A 3D Atlanta skyline sculpture — Bank of America Plaza and the Midtown skyline in matte black, a genuine desk or shelf piece he'll actually display.
2. Vintage Braves or Falcons memorabilia — tied to a specific season, more meaningful than current-roster gear.
3. A World of Coca-Cola gift set — a real Atlanta institution.
4. Real Georgia peach preserves or pecans — genuinely local and memorable.
5. A framed skyline photo print for his office or den — a professional, lasting piece.
6. High Museum of Art membership — for a design or art-minded recipient.
7. A custom map print marking his Atlanta — highly personal, genuinely memorable.
8. A Braves or Hawks game ticket — a memorable experience gift.
9. Whiskey or craft spirits from a Georgia distillery — a genuine local craft pick.
10. A Waffle House-themed gift, for the true Atlanta loyalist — a fun, genuinely local gesture.
11. Barbecue sauce or rub from a real Atlanta-area smokehouse — a genuine local food gift.
12. A Georgia Aquarium membership or ticket — a memorable family-friendly experience.
